## D71 — olp-plugin/ (OpenClaw gateway plugin)

Port OCP ocp-plugin/index.js (311 lines) → OLP olp-plugin/index.js (482
lines) as the /olp Telegram+Discord slash command, but MINUS mutations
(no /olp keys keygen, no /olp keys revoke, no /olp restart, no /olp logs
— all of these require SSH out of chat for security).

Plugin shape:
- olp-plugin/index.js — registers /olp command via OpenClaw api.registerCommand
- olp-plugin/openclaw.plugin.json — manifest, apiKey REQUIRED, proxyUrl
  default http://127.0.0.1:4567 (matches D60)
- olp-plugin/package.json — minimal: name/version/type:module + OpenClaw
  discovery block
- olp-plugin/README.md — install + configure + use docs; documents the
  "no mutations from chat" security stance and the dedicated-bot-key
  pattern (don't share maintainer's personal key with the bot)

Subcommand parity with olp CLI (D64-D67):
- /olp status   → GET /v0/management/status         (owner-only)
- /olp health   → GET /health                       (public-ok)
- /olp usage    → GET /v0/management/dashboard-data (owner-only)
- /olp models   → GET /v1/models                    (public-ok)
- /olp cache    → GET /cache/stats                  (owner-only)
- /olp providers → local cross-ref                  (public-ok)
- /olp chain show [<model>] → local                 (public-ok, advisory
  if no FS access — defer to ssh + olp chain show)
- /olp doctor   → informational (HTTP doctor endpoint deferred; advisory
  to ssh + olp doctor for live use)
- /olp help     → usage text

Port resolution: OLP_PROXY_URL env → OLP_PORT env → plugin config
proxyUrl → http://127.0.0.1:4567. Output: Telegram/Discord monospace
code block with status icons (🟢🟡🔴). Long responses truncated for the
4096-char message limit.

No npm deps. OpenClaw provides Telegram/Discord transport; plugin uses
fetch + node builtins only.

## D72 — docs/integrations/*.md (6 IDE pages + index)

Per the Phase 4 brainstorm prior-art survey + ADR 0010 § Out-of-scope
posture for Claude Code:

- continue.md    — config.yaml (NOT config.json); apiBase; requestOptions.headers
- cline.md       — "OpenAI Compatible" provider; Cline #7128 base-URL UI bug warning
- cursor.md     ⚠️  — known base-URL fragility; only enable models OLP serves
- aider.md       — OPENAI_API_BASE env + openai/ prefix; .env support
- claude-code.md  — explicitly NOT supported per ADR 0010 § /v1/messages defer
                     rationale; recommended alternative: Cline + OLP
- openclaw.md    — install olp-plugin via CLI or symlink; configure apiKey;
                    restart gateway

Each ~60-120 lines: status / quick setup / known issues / OLP-specific
notes / test-it command. docs/integrations/README.md is the index.
